Size and Media

The Birth of Venus is a large painting, measuring 173 x 279 cm. It was created using tempera on canvas, a popular medium during the Italian Renaissance.

Style and Date

Created in the late 15th century, The Birth of Venus is an excellent example of the Early Renaissance style. Botticelli's use of linear perspective, naturalism, and classical subject matter set the stage for future developments in Western art.

Location

Today, The Birth of Venus can be found on display at the prestigious Uffizi Gallery in Florence, Italy. The painting is housed alongside other masterpieces from the Italian Renaissance, making it a must-see for any art lover.

History

Commissioned by the Medici family of Florence, The Birth of Venus was completed around 1485. The painting depicts the goddess Venus as she emerges from the sea foam, symbolizing the birth of love and beauty. Botticelli's interpretation of this classical subject matter has influenced countless artists throughout history.

Interpretation

While there is no single text that provides the precise imagery of The Birth of Venus, many art historians have proposed various sources and interpretations for the painting. Some believe it to be a representation of Neoplatonic ideals, while others see it as an allegory for the power of love.

Botticelli's Legacy

Sandro Botticelli (1445-1510) was one of the greatest painters of the Florentine Renaissance, known for his masterpieces The Birth of Venus and La Primavera. His innovative style and classical subject matter continue to inspire artists today.
